I am doing performance testing on SAP EP 7.0 through LoadRunner. I am trying to test the Portal landing page (customized and has more content) for 20 concurrent users.
I am using HP LoadRunner to create Load (10 users) at a time, The Landing page download is getting delay (because it has more content), meanwhile the Max DB Session (100 sessions) increase maximum upto 75.
Because of this session increase, portal landing page getting more delay. How can i solve this issue?
Can anybody please explain the DB Session concept?

Thanks for clarifying. The maximum number of sessions is controlled by the MAXUSERTASKS parameter. You will find an explanation in notes 846890 and 1173395. I am not aware of MAXUSERTASKS having a performance impact but I might be wrong there (I only deal with this DBMS myself in the context of the APO LiveCache).
